In several ways. The type of mining may be changed to a form that has a lesser impact on surroundings, and mined land can be reclaimed, restored, or placed into other uses.

The two types of mining are Open-cast mining and Underground mining. Underground mining is further divided in to Adit mining and Shaft mining.

In mining, tailings are the unwanted byproduct that affects the environment. But with the separation process called GravSep, acid forming mineral content of the tailings is reduced. The result: cleaner tailings. Mining usually produces byproducts, called tailings, that are harmful to the environment. But with the physical separation process, which is GravSep, harmful substances in the tailings are significantly reduced.

Implementing sustainable mining practices, such as minimizing the use of harmful chemicals and reusing water resources, can help reduce the negative environmental impacts of mining. Promoting land reclamation and rehabilitation efforts can help restore ecosystems and minimize the loss of biodiversity caused by mining activities. Encouraging responsible mining companies to adopt technologies that reduce air and water pollution, as well as the release of greenhouse gases, can also help mitigate the effects of mining on the environment.
